Ferrari F430

Hi all, thought I would post a couple pics of my Revell F430. The paint is a not-so-smooth Tamiya Camel Yellow. I used the revell Focus racing seats, but otherwise its boxstock. I painted the rims Metallizer aluminum plate with Tamiya black spokes, I think it helps set off those red calipers.




I had a lot of assembly problems, nothing went the way it should. So many, that I was hesitant to start on my Revell SuperAmerica, but so far it has went together so much easier.
